Meanwhile, about fluoride... I grew up in Rotterdam, Holland a place of notoriously polluted water (River Rhine, So water treatment was always a challenge. Notoriously, after WW2, there wasa a brief period in the fifties and early sixties, when Holland adopted water fluoridation, from our American liberators, who had a great deal of credibility at that time. However within about ten years, there was enough research in circulation that the practice was abolished based mostly on medical evidence of the toxicity. The same happened in most of Western Europe. When I later moved to the US, I was completely flabbergasterd that large parts of the country are still doing it, including NYC, where I now live.
